摘要: 分隔池塘养殖系统是绿色高效池塘养殖设施研究发展的重点方向之一。本文提出了分隔池塘养殖系统的定义,阐述了系统设计的原理和国内外发展历程,归纳了标准分隔池塘、简易分隔池塘和流水槽池塘3种国外发展的主要系统模式类型,通过文献收集和实地调研对3种系统模式的研究进展和发展趋势进行了系统的梳理,比较了国内外发展模式的养殖品种、水循环方式、研究概况和产业应用情况,通过进一步讨论分级序批养殖池塘、跑道池养殖池塘2种在国内具备良好发展前景系统模式的优缺点,提出了下一步的研究重点和发展方向,为分隔池塘养殖系统的结构优化和技术提升提供参考。

Abstract: Partitioned Aquaculture System is one of the key directions of research and development on green and efficient aquaculture facilities. In this paper, the definition of Partitioned Aquaculture System is proposed, the principle of systems design and the development history at home and abroad are expounded, and three types of system models developed abroad are summarized: Partitioned Pond Aquaculture System, Split-Ponds and In-Pond Raceways. The research progress and development trend of the three system models are systematically sorted out through literature collection and field research, and the species cultured, water circulation mode, research progress and application status in development models at home and abroad are compared. By further discussing the advantages and disadvantages of sequencing aquaculture pond and in-pond raceways with good development prospects at home, the next research focus and development direction are put forward, which can provide reference for structural optimization and technical upgrading of Partitioned Aquaculture System.
